Curriculum
The International Finance program in Turkey is comprehensive education at the intersection of economics, finance, and international business. Over four years, students master tools for analysis and decision-making in global financial context.
Year 1 — Foundation of the Profession
- Micro- and Macroeconomics — forms understanding of economic processes
- Mathematics for Finance — provides analytical tools
- Accounting Fundamentals — reveals business language
- Introduction to Finance — introduces principles of financial markets
Years 2-3 — Professional Skills
- International Financial Markets — immerses in world of currencies, stocks, and bonds
- Corporate Finance — teaches making investment decisions
- Risk Management — reveals methods for protecting against financial losses
- International Banking — introduces global banking system
Year 4 — Professional Start
- Internship — in bank or investment company provides real work experience
- Diploma Project — demonstrates ability to analyze complex financial situations
- Electives — in derivatives, fintech, or Islamic finance help find specialization

Interesting Fact
The Forex market is the largest financial market in the world with daily turnover exceeding $6 trillion, surpassing the annual GDP of most countries. This market never sleeps: trading goes 24 hours a day, moving from Sydney to Tokyo, then to London and New York. About 90% of all currency transactions involve only seven currency pairs, and the US dollar participates in 88% of all trades.
